An OTT giant offers Massive for Akhanda Digital Release

Most of the theatres in India are ready to close because of the second wave of Covid-19. Big budget movies, which already announced the release date for the coming months, have also pushed the releases as they cannot dare when the country is witnessing a surge in infections.

It has been rumoured for a while now that even a big producer like Suresh Babu is looking to close the theatres in his handover. With this, the digital platforms are picking up again.

It was already announced that Salman Khan’s ‘Radhe‘ is opting for a hybrid release. Now, the OTT companies are stepping up to buy movies that have a bit of a craze even in Tollywood at huge amounts.

Against this backdrop, a leading streaming giant has approached the producers of Balakrishna’s upcoming film ‘Akhanda‘. It is heard that they offered a whopping Rs 65 crore for the ‘Akhanda’ digital release.

However, it seems that the producers denied their request considering the craze for Balayya and Boyapati Srinu’s combination among the fans.
